The K&F CONCEPT M42 to M4/3 Lens Mount Adapter is a premium all-metal adapter designed to mount M42 screw mount lenses onto Micro Four Thirds cameras. It supports manual focus to infinity, ensuring sharp images without electronic contacts or autofocus. Compatible with a wide range of Olympus PEN, OM-D, Panasonic Lumix, and cinema cameras, this adapter offers a durable, precise fit with a simple twist-lock mechanism, making it the perfect tool for photographers seeking to breathe new life into vintage lenses.

In the case of the older screw in lens attachment takes seconds and the installation is firm and solid. A few words of caution however. Your camera and the lens it has available for it have been designed as a system. Everything is balanced in terms of size and weight - things you considered and appealed to you when you bought it. Adding a lens not designed for your camera will throw all out of balance - literally. In addition lens designed and made decades ago were the best they could be for the price at the time. Their performance was often stellar, sometimes rubbish and usually OK. In some ways these lens can be seen as motor cars from the 1960s. You may admire a classic sports car like an E-type Jaguar or similar. You may have had one at the time and remember how it performed or you may simply want to drive one. But the experience may not be as you remember or imagine. Your beautiful head turning sleek car is probably very uncomfortable by today’s standards. You may not be able to find some where to drive it to the maximum. It may become a ‘Sunny Sunday’ car, only coming out when the weather is perfect and sitting in the garage most of the time. Your old lens may be like that sports car. ‘Good glass’ optimised for film cameras from years ago may be unforgiving on a digital sensor. Modern focusing aids like peak focusing may not always work. Your idea of getting a cool looking cheap super telephoto lens by using an adapter on a 2x crop sensor in practice may result in a ‘monster’ you can use only in certain specific, limited circumstances. And as stated at the top of this review your camera may feel heavy and unbalanced - something to consider, especially if you have small hands or arthritis. But if you have read this far and are prepared to accept that you may not get an award winning photo first time - or indeed ever - simply want to experiment and at the same time improve or recapture your photographic skills and not rely on your modern digital camera doing all the thinking, then your camera, this adapter and that lens in the garage or cupboard or drawer will get along fine. And best of all you will have fun and may even surprise yourself.

Works well, and feels solid and well made. ...
Works well, and feels solid and well made. All lines up as it should on the mount, and focuses to infinity (possibly slightly beyond; I may tweak this a little). One thing to note is that there's no stop-down button, just a fixed ring to hold the pin in, so you can't use the preset apreture on most lenses.

A friend gave me an old M42 200 mm lens since hewas unable to make use of it. I bpoght this adapter to see if the lens was still viable. The adapter connects to both the lens and the camera very positively and cleanly. A good sign is that the red focussing mark and the aperture equivalent are top dead centre. The lens is of the early aperture preset type where you set the desired aperture, but the lens remains fully open until you spin the ring adjacent to the aperture ring to close down prior to exposure. Clearly one can either use a meter and set the shutter speed manually or leave the camera meter to set it at the time of exposure. Clearly the exposure time displayed will only be accurate with the lens stopped down. Focus will obviously be manual, but with Olympus bodies you will get image stabilisation if you manually set the focal length. An interesting experience using a lens designed for cameras several generations of development back, pretty well using the same techniques we were using 60 years ago.
